If it's https, then the original request - up to hitting the load balancer - was secure, and we shouldn't try and redirect, or we're back into infinite loop territory.
You can change that with this rule. There are several ways to configure a reverse proxy. Once the original mapping and rule is created, you can then enter additional entries straight into the web. You can find the list of server variables and their documentation here: All requests now for TSOriginal.
Somethign else that has happened more than once to me, and the main reason why cyotek. Well, let us pretend we are the browser and look at things from its perspective, and you tell me whether Client-Side Redirection should be transparent or not: You can test the connection by browsing to https: Create a Rule Referencing the Mapping Now that you have created the mapping, you must create the rule to reference the mapping.
If you want http: If it does not exist yet, it needs to be created again. For this example we will leave everything unchecked and set a status of in the dropdown menu. After all, the user must have download the HTML in plain text in order for the browser to display it. By wrapping the expression in brackets I create a capturing group I can use elsewhere.
Understand IIS rewrite and redirect rules Feb 21, A while ago, I answered a question on stackoverflow asking clarifications about the IIS rewrite module and how back references work.
Your three new rules will look like this: First, let's look at the different types of redirects that are available in IIS 7: Have a look at this tutorial to see how it is done: Most organisations already have a certificate provider like Digicert, Entrust, GeoTrust, etc.
For this example we have removed the site redirect we had placed on TSOriginal. From the Actions pane on the right, select the Add Rewrite Map 5.
You can find more articles on this blog by going to the homepage. One such place is the referrer information collected by web forms processing engines. Check with your IT department to get one installed or contact a well known certificate provider.
What is the IIS rewrite module?
Click on If you get the warning message below, click OK. Fortunately however, when a load balancer forwards traffic to the final server, it generally includes some extra headers such as X-Forwarded-For and X-Forwarded-Proto. From the Actions pane on the right, click Add Mapping Entry 8.
If you want your action to depend on a part or all of the requested URL, you can use back references to recall those values. The stopProcessing attribute means no other rules will be processed if this rule is a match. These are meant for testing purposes and will not be considered secured by most browsers.
Here are the results for the test: Redirect to a Different URL The first and most simple of the redirects will go from one domain to another, useful if you are changing domain names. Read more… pfSense with Snort Build Follow our build of network perimeter firewall, router, and protection device for a small office.
However, the rule is still deactivated. I have never liked this approach, especially the latter part. Once the extension is downloaded you can install it on the server.
There is a pair of rules in this case each for one of the two ways. Also, these instructions are written for the 2.
Lots of things to try and remember! The rules work on the same URL patterns or the similar lists of pages to match. The changes are now in place and if we navigate to TSOriginal. If the secure connection is terminated at the balancer, then this can be a problem for the most common method of redirecting traffic, which is to check if the current request's scheme is HTTP and perform a redirect if it is.The ISAPI redirector with version can perform log rotation, with configuration and behaviour similar to the rotatelogs program provided with Apache HTTP Server.
To configure log rotation, configure a log_file, and one of the log_rotationtime or log_filesize options. IIS Application Request Routing offers administrators the ability to create powerful routing rules based on the URL, HTTP headers, and server variables to determine the most appropriate Web application server for.
Feb 25, · Setup IIS URL Rewrite to redirect root request to dominicgaudious.net Feb 24, PM | phack | LINK I have several re-write rules setup using the IIS URL Rewrite add-on.
Jan 17, · URL-rewrite module to redirect HTTP to HTTPS automatically. Section 4: Deployment Here i will show you how to deploy "ASP" website directly from visual studio into IIS server, also i will show.
In IIS 7, writing a URL redirect using the HTTP Redirect when referring to a subfolder to the root site, would cause an infinite loop. This blog entry will show you how to create a URL Rewrite in IIS 7 to allow the redirect to work correctly. Jul 23, · Using IIS with URL Rewrite and Symfony July 23, luiscberrocal Leave a comment Go to comments The IIS URL Rewrite is IIS module that promises to do what the mod_rewrite does for Apache.Download